Okeanis Eco Tankers Increases Dividend
The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, August 21st. Stockholders of record on Friday, August 14th were paid a dividend of $5.25 per share. This represents a $21.00 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 32.5%. This is a positive change from Okeanis Eco Tankers's previous quarterly dividend of $2.00. The ex-dividend date was Friday, August 14th. Okeanis Eco Tankers's payout ratio is currently 195.90%.

Okeanis Eco Tankers Corp. is a Marshall Islands–incorporated, publicly traded shipping company specializing in the ownership and operation of eco-design product tankers. The company made its debut on the New York Stock Exchange under the ticker “ECO” in May 2019 following an initial public offering. It focuses on the acquisition of newbuilding medium-range (MR) and long-range (LR) product tankers designed to deliver enhanced fuel efficiency and reduced emissions.
As of its public listing, Okeanis Eco Tankers' fleet comprises twelve eco-efficient vessels built by Hyundai Samho Heavy Industries in South Korea.
